The Diploma in Education and Training (DET) course is for those carrying out a teaching role and who need to gain Qualified Teacher Learning and Skills status (QTLS).

This qualification is equivalent to the Certificate in Education within the Framework for Higher Education Qualifications (FHEQ). The qualification can lead to Qualified Teacher of Learning and Skills (QTLS) status once combined with continuing professional development and a period of professional formation. It is a Level 5 award with 120 credits.

The Diploma comprises Part 1 and Part 2 and there is a requirement for a minimum of 100 hours of teaching.

What You Will Study?

  1. To achieve the Level 5 Diploma in Education and Training, candidates must achieve a minimum of 120 credits
  2. 75 credits must be achieved from the mandatory units in group A, plus a minimum of 45 credits from optional units in group B
  3. A minimum of 61 credits must be at Level 5 (therefore a minimum of 6 optional credits must be achieved at level 5)
  4. To achieve the qualification, there is a requirement for your teaching practice to be observed and assessed on performance

Group A

  • Teaching, learning and assessment in education and training – 20 credits
  • Developing teaching, learning and assessment in education and training –20 credits
  • Theories, principles and models in education and training – 20 credits
  • Wider professional practice and development in education and training –20 credits
